Miss May Curtis, Mr. Richard • and Turner Aylor of Washington, D.C., and Mr. Reaben Aylor were Sunday dinner guests of Mr and Mrs. Fred Frye and fam' & ' ■ \ Mrs. Maggie Hunter spent Wednesday in Front RoyaL

The Junior League is ghdng a Benefit Social at the Flint Hill School, Friday night, February 8. This social is ghren for the benefit of the March of Dimes. Music is by Mr. Hank Johnson of Front Royal, Va. His latest recordings will be played. Admission is 60c. Refreshments will be on sale. Plan now to cornel

It is still not too late to give your donation to the March of Dimes drive to fight polio. Your district chairman and her workers arar in charge of the drive in your community. Give now. . Mrs. John Barbour is on the sick list with laryngitis.
